Handover for the weekly eng sync: I'm transferring ownership of Duskrunner, our nightly backfill scheduler, to Priya. Current state: all jobs healthy except the ledger-reconciliation backfill, which retries once nightly due to a slow upstream from the Kestwick warehouse. Retry logic, window sizing, and concurrency caps were all tuned carefully last quarter — please don't change them without a load test. For full transparency at the sync, the production instance runs with these configuration values.

settings of hawep-kadug:
RALAEL_HOST=ralael.tolvaqlabs.internal
RALAEL_PORT=9000

## Configuration

The Larkspan rollout framework reads all settings from a single env file loaded at boot. Flags are evaluated against cohort definitions fetched from the Perrin control plane every thirty seconds. Reviewers should confirm that `LARKSPAN_COHORT_SOURCE` points at the staging plane, not production. The line directly after the cohort source entry must set the control-plane signing secret.

env line for fafof-fahag: LEDGER_TOKEN5=f8790

TICKET: Nightly reindex drift on Larkspool search tier. The cron job on staging runs with different shard counts than prod, so reindex timings diverge and alerts fire at 03:00. Root cause: someone hand-edited staging last sprint. Please review the reconciliation patch. Current effective values on the drifted node follow below.

deployment values, bajop-yahaf:
[holax]
host = holax.tolvaqsys.corp
user = holax_svc
database = holax_prod

**Mgmt Meeting Minutes — Retiring the Brightline Range**

Quick recap for sales leads at Fenholt Supplies: we agreed to retire the Brightline fixture range by year-end. Remaining stock moves to clearance pricing next month, and accounts on standing orders get migrated to the Lumetta range. Trade-in incentives were approved in principle. The confidential note on next steps sits just below.

board note of bajof-bajeg: The pricing group signed off on a budget of $13.4 million for Project Sildor. The renewal with Lamixek Holdings closes at $48.9 million a year, 49 percent above the last contract.